a) Take a P.i.B wavefuntion for an electron in an 8 nm long 1D box and consider dividing the entire length of the box in 8 equal segments of 1 nm each. Calculate the ratio of theprobability of finding the electron in the first segment (x = 0 1 nm) to the probability offinding it in the fourth segment (x = 3 4 nm) for the n=1 state. The fact that this ratio is notequal to one is only true because of quantum mechanics. b) Repeat the previous calculation for the n=41 state. What is the ratio? c) What is the limit as n -> infinity? (what does this tell us about why a macroscopic particle moving about in a box with no potential has a uniform probability of being foundthroughoutthe box?)
